Jalanie George's Top 6 College Choices: A Rising Star's Journey (2026)

The college football recruiting world is abuzz with the latest developments in the recruitment of five-star edge rusher Jalanie George. With a growing list of offers and a rapidly narrowing list of finalists, the 2028 prospect is a hot commodity, and his decision will have significant implications for the future of college football.

George, a towering 6-foot-5, 245-pound athlete from Goodyear, Arizona, has been a standout performer on the high school gridiron. His impressive statistics, including 54 tackles, 16 tackles for loss, 6.5 sacks, and a forced fumble, have not gone unnoticed. According to the 247Sports scouting director, George possesses high upside, all-conference potential, and the physical attributes to succeed at the NFL level. His commitment to cleaning up the trash on the field showcases his tenacity and determination, traits that are invaluable in the world of college football.

The recent announcement that George is down to six finalists - Miami, Washington, Ohio State, Auburn, Oklahoma, and the Florida Gators - has sent shockwaves through the recruiting landscape. The list of schools that have extended offers to George is impressive, including Arizona, Arizona State, California, Georgia, Colorado, Indiana, Kansas, Kansas State, LSU, and Maryland. This level of interest from top-tier programs highlights George's status as one of the nation's most coveted prospects.
